Exchanges (NSE/BSE)
No new material NSE or BSE circulars this window beyond routine settlement-calendar, new-listing and surveillance notices. Category I (F&O-eligible) stocks completed a fifth live day of the Closing Auction Session on 7 August, with no operational issues reported since the 3 August go-live.
RBI, IFSCA & other
No new material RBI or IFSCA items this window. The comment window on RBI's draft Foreign Exchange Management (Foreign Investment) Rules, 2026 — which would replace the NDI Rules, 2019 — remains open until 31 August; no new IFSCA circulars or consultation papers bearing on equities this window.

Rest of Asia — Emerging Markets
South Korea's market-structure safeguards for single-stock leveraged ETFs faced fresh scrutiny after the Korea Exchange triggered another sell-side sidecar on 6 August. KRX halted program sell orders for five minutes from 10:18am as KOSPI 200 futures fell more than 5% amid a semiconductor-led selloff — its 46th sidecar activation this year. Separately, a former Seoul city councillor filed a criminal complaint with the Supreme Prosecutors' Office against Financial Services Commission Chairman Lee Eog-won on 6 August, alleging he directed officials to skip stress-testing when single-stock leveraged ETFs tied to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ix were approved for listing in May; the FSC's draft Capital Markets Act amendment to let regulators temporarily cut leveraged-ETF ratios from 2x to as low as 1.1x in emergencies remains in preparation.
